Harlan’s Holiday Colt ‘Luckiest’ in the Ontario Derby

Updated: September 20, 2015 at 10:00 pm

Lucky Lindy graduated in his second start in a rained-off special weight at Woodbine in June and was second by a nose stretching out over the turf in an allowance July 5. He rallied to finish second in the 1 1/8-mile Toronto Cup July 26 and was a well-beaten third to Danish Dynaformer (Dynaformer) in the 1 1/2-mile Breeders’ S. Aug. 16. Cutting back in distance here, Lucky Lindy settled in third, one off the rail, as Decision Day (Macho Uno) scampered to the front from his wide draw and doled out fractions of :25 1/5, :50 and 1:14. The Augustin Stable colorbearer pounced on the tiring Decision Day at the head of the lane and cruised home under a hand ride. Favored Billy’s Star closed to take second.

“It was only his fifth start,” said trainer Mark Frostad. “He had some 2-year-old issues, so it took him a little longer (to get to the races). He’s coming along beautifully and I think his best racing days are ahead of him.”
